diff --git a/.github/workflows/core.yml b/.github/workflows/core.yml index afab9705..51199b54 100644 --- a/.github/workflows/core.yml +++ b/.github/workflows/core.yml @@ -76,6 +76,7 @@ jobs: echo 'org.gradle.vfs.watch=true' >> gradle.properties echo 'org.gradle.jvmargs=-Xmx2048m' >> gradle.properties echo 'android.native.buildOutput=verbose' >> gradle.properties + echo 'buildCache { local { removeUnusedEntriesAfterDays = 1 } }' >> settings.gradle.kts ln -s $(which ninja) $(dirname $(which cmake)) # https://issuetracker.google.com/issues/206099937 echo "cmake.dir=$(dirname $(dirname $(which cmake)))" >> local.properties ./gradlew zipAll diff --git a/build.gradle.kts b/build.gradle.kts index f542d005..f229efdc 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-160,10 +160,9 @@ fun Project.configureBaseExtension() { ).joinToString(" ") arguments.addAll( arrayOf( + "-DCMAKE_BUILD_TYPE=Release", "-DCMAKE_CXX_FLAGS_RELEASE=$configFlags", - "-DCMAKE_CXX_FLAGS_RELWITHDEBINFO=$configFlags", "-DCMAKE_C_FLAGS_RELEASE=$configFlags", - "-DCMAKE_C_FLAGS_RELWITHDEBINFO=$configFlags", "-DDEBUG_SYMBOLS_PATH=${buildDir.absolutePath}/symbols", ) ) diff --git a/dex2oat/src/main/cpp/dex2oat.c b/dex2oat/src/main/cpp/dex2oat.c index aa622853..0a8b6d87 100644 --- a/dex2oat/src/main/cpp/dex2oat.c +++ b/dex2oat/src/main/cpp/dex2oat.c @@ -99,7 +99,7 @@ static void write_int(int fd, int val) { } int main(int argc, char **argv) { - LOGI("dex2oat wrapper"); + LOGD("dex2oat wrapper"); struct sockaddr_un sock; sock.sun_family = AF_UNIX; snprintf(sock.sun_path, sizeof(sock.sun_path), "%s/dex2oat.sock", kTmpDir + 12); diff --git a/settings.gradle.kts b/settings.gradle.kts index 29b1d60f..3515248a 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-38,5 +38,3 @@ include( ":services:daemon-service", ":services:xposed-service:interface", ) - -buildCache { local { removeUnusedEntriesAfterDays = 1 } }